Step-by-step explanation:
The given values lie on a line with slope
... m = (975 -725)/(30 -20) = 250/10 = 25
The initial value shown gives the y-intercept, so the length can be calculated using the equation
... y = 25x +225
_____
The length after 86 days will be
... y = 25·86 +225 = 2375 . . . feet

Step-by-step explanation:
Let use the following trigonometric identities:
![\sin^{2}\theta = \frac{1-\cos 2\cdot \theta}{2} \\\cos^{2}\theta = \frac{1+\cos 2\cdot \theta}{2}](https://tex.z-dn.net/?f=%5Csin%5E%7B2%7D%5Ctheta%20%3D%20%5Cfrac%7B1-%5Ccos%202%5Ccdot%20%5Ctheta%7D%7B2%7D%20%5C%5C%5Ccos%5E%7B2%7D%5Ctheta%20%3D%20%5Cfrac%7B1%2B%5Ccos%202%5Ccdot%20%5Ctheta%7D%7B2%7D)
Then, the equation is simplified by substituting its components:
![x = 1.40\cdot \left(\frac{1-\cos 2\cdot \theta}{2} \right)\cdot \left(\frac{1+\cos 2\cdot \theta}{2} \right)](https://tex.z-dn.net/?f=x%20%3D%201.40%5Ccdot%20%5Cleft%28%5Cfrac%7B1-%5Ccos%202%5Ccdot%20%5Ctheta%7D%7B2%7D%20%20%5Cright%29%5Ccdot%20%5Cleft%28%5Cfrac%7B1%2B%5Ccos%202%5Ccdot%20%5Ctheta%7D%7B2%7D%20%5Cright%29)
![x = 0.35\cdot (1-\cos^{2}2\cdot \theta)](https://tex.z-dn.net/?f=x%20%3D%200.35%5Ccdot%20%281-%5Ccos%5E%7B2%7D2%5Ccdot%20%5Ctheta%29)
![x = 0.35\cdot \sin^{2}2\cdot \theta](https://tex.z-dn.net/?f=x%20%3D%200.35%5Ccdot%20%5Csin%5E%7B2%7D2%5Ccdot%20%5Ctheta)
![x = 0.35\cdot \left(\frac{1-\cos 4\cdot \theta}{2} \right)](https://tex.z-dn.net/?f=x%20%3D%200.35%5Ccdot%20%5Cleft%28%5Cfrac%7B1-%5Ccos%204%5Ccdot%20%5Ctheta%7D%7B2%7D%20%20%5Cright%29)
![x = 0.175\cdot (1-\cos 4\cdot \theta)](https://tex.z-dn.net/?f=x%20%3D%200.175%5Ccdot%20%281-%5Ccos%204%5Ccdot%20%5Ctheta%29)
